In a commanding 3-0 World Cup victory over Wales, Marcus Rashford and Phil Foden made the most of their elevation to England’s starting lineup by taking centre stage.
Manchester United star Marcus Rashford scored a brilliant free kick after Foden won a free kick in the 50th minute after a jinking run, and his Manchester City colleague also scored a minute later.
Rashford drilled his third of the tournament through the legs of Wales goalkeeper Danny Ward to make sure of top spot in Group B and set up a last-16 showdown with Senegal.
Wales’ first World Cup finals appearance since 1958 ended with a solitary point to their name and captain Gareth Bale departing through injury at halftime.

Les Blues progressed to the World Cup final with a 2-0 victory over a strong Morocco at Al Bayt Stadium thanks to an early goal from Theo Hernandez and a late goal by substitute Randal Kolo Muani.
France will take on Lionel Messi and Argentina in the finals as they continue to be on track to become the first team to do so since Brazil in 1962.
Morocco have been the surprise team of Qatar 2022 and Walid Regragui’s side responded superbly after Hernandez’s fifth-minute opener, pinning back the world champions for significant periods in a display of great courage and skill.
But Eintracht Frankfurt striker Kolo Muani proved to be France’s unlikely hero, scoring with his first touch after Kylian Mbappe had a shot blocked 11 minutes from time.

Argentina progressed to the World Cup final with a commanding 3-0 semifinal victory over Croatia at Lusail Stadium thanks to Lionel Messi and Julian Alvarez.
During a cagey first half-hour, Croatia, looking to repeat their triumphs from 2018, were the superior team, but Manchester City attacker Alvarez was taken down by Croatian goalkeeper Dominik Livakovic as he lifted the ball over him.
Livakovic was his country’s hero in the shootout wins over Japan and Brazil but he was left with no chance as Messi thumped his penalty into the top-right corner to join Kylian Mbappe at the top of the Golden Boot leading scorer race.
The goal scorers combined delightfully in the 69th minute when Messi tormented Josko Gvardiol with a winding dribble before setting up Alvarez for his fourth of the tournament. Alvarez then tenaciously bundled his way through a poorly organized Croatia backline on the counter-attack to double the lead.
Messi almost scored his second, exchanging passes with Enzo Fernandez to draw a fine stop from Livakovic at his near post, but he had one more piece of magic to give Alvarez a second goal that was far more straightforward than his first.
Argentina will take on the winner of the second semi-finals between Morocco and France in the finals.
